LANE COUNTY, Ore. (KPTV) – A Portland man died in a two-vehicle crash in Lane County early Tuesday morning, according to Oregon State Police.

The crash happened just before 6:30 a.m. on Highway 58, near milepost 36.5. OSP says a white GMC Yukon was going eastbound on the highway when it crossed into the westbound lane and collided head-on with a gray Volvo semi-truck that was hauling a 52-foot box trailer.

The driver of the GMC, 45-year-old David William Dickey, died at the scene. OSP says the driver of the semi-truck was not hurt.

The highway was impacted for about three hours due to the crash investigation.

No other details have been released.
